C#开发的GIS小区物业管理系统:理论与实践

5星 · 超过95%的资源 需积分: 10 11 下载量 187 浏览量 更新于2024-07-30 1 收藏 3.24MB PDF 举报
本篇硕士学位论文深入探讨了"基于C#"的小区物业管理系统的设计与实现,针对数字化小区日益增长的需求,传统的物业管理方式已显得落后。作者祝铭钰,专业为软件工程,在北京工业大学的指导下,沈琦和李媛教授的协助下,将地理信息系统(GIS)技术引入到物业管理系统中,以提升系统的可视化管理和效率。 论文首先阐述了背景,指出传统物业管理系统无法满足数字化小区的复杂需求,强调了GIS的强大处理能力在实现精细化管理中的关键作用。研究者选择ArcGIS Engine作为开发平台,ArcSDE作为空间数据引擎,VB作为二次开发工具,这表明了技术路线的明确性。 接下来,论文详细介绍了系统开发的关键技术和理论,包括GIS技术的基础概念、组件式GIS的优势、空间数据管理、空间数据引擎ArcSDE的功能以及ArcGIS Engine的二次开发技术。在系统设计上,作者特别关注空间数据与属性数据的整合,通过ArcSDE和SQL Server进行高效分类存储,并采用空间数据的分层管理,构建了与GIS数据库相结合的高效数据结构。 在具体开发过程中,论文着重展示了GIS技术在物业管理系统中的实际应用,如图形操作、图层管理、双向查询、数据编辑和分析统计等功能的实现,这些功能大大提高了物业管理的效率和精度,使得空间信息和属性信息得以一体化管理,并且实现了管理工作在直观地图上的可视化呈现。 此外,作者强调了该系统的优势在于它没有依赖大型商业GIS平台,而是采用了灵活的GIS组件技术,降低了开发成本,推动了GIS技术从高端领域走向大众化的实用应用。这对于开发自主的GIS信息管理软件具有重要的参考价值,具有很高的实用性,对提升小区物业管理的智能化水平具有显著的推动作用。 关键词:物业管理、信息系统、GIS、ArcSDE,都精确地概括了论文的核心内容和研究重点。这篇论文不仅理论性强,而且注重实践应用,对于了解和推动C#在小区物业管理系统的实际应用具有重要意义。